Road Safety Week from January 11th to 17th.
Jalandhar, January 10.01.2020
Secretary Regional Transport Authority (RTA) Nayan Jassal today embarked a signature campaign at her office to mark the beginning of the Road Safety Week from January 11th to 17th.
Starting the signature campaign, Secretary RTA said that road safety could save many lives adding that while driving a number of things like traffic rules, signboards, wearing seat belt and helmets must also be kept in mind. She said that ideally speed limit of the vehicle should be between 40-55 Km/h and driving under the influence of alcohol, drugs and others must be avoided. Likewise, Nayan Jassal also said that proper maintenance of vehicle should also be ensured.
The Secretary RTA further said that driving was a careful activity and it should be performed with both mental and physical alertness. She also insisted that safety rules must be followed out as duty not as a burden or restriction adding that every driver should show his responsibility towards the society. Nayan Jassal said that the campaign would be further carried during the coming days in the educational institutes of the district (SB)
